John Robinson was born in Worcester UK in 1981 and studied art at Falmouth University and Byam Shaw school of art in London.
The artist´s work is about how to paint a figure. Frequently myself. I want to revisit the popular theme of self portraiture and do it in a new way.

The work is often quite small scale and is executed in raw umber on canvases. He has lived in Madrid for a few years, initially as artist in residence at the Prado Museum and inspired by the dark spaces of Goya and the allegories of Velazquez. The artist wants his pictures to be as dark allegories of psychological states, but that can be fun too.

John Robinson’s work can be found in public collections around the world.
